# §9706. Freshwater monitoring along the coast

- (a) **Data availability assessment—** The [Administrator](/usc/15/9701.md?p=1) shall assess the availability of short- and long-term data on large-scale freshwater flooding into oceans, bays, and estuaries, including data on—
  - (1) flow rate, including discharge;
  - (2) conductivity;
  - (3) oxygen concentration;
  - (4) nutrient load;
  - (5) water temperature; and
  - (6) sediment load.
- (b) **Data needs assessment—** The [Administrator](/usc/15/9701.md?p=1) shall assess the need for additional data to assess and predict the effect of the flooding and freshwater discharge described in [subsection (a)](#a).
- (c) **Inventory of data needs—** Based on the assessments required by subsections [(a)](#a) and [(b)](#b), the [Administrator](/usc/15/9701.md?p=1) shall create an inventory of data needs with respect to the flooding and freshwater discharge described in subsections [(a)](#a) and [(b)](#b).
- (d) **Planning—** In planning for the collection of additional data necessary for ecosystem-based modeling of the effect of the flooding and freshwater discharge described in subsections [(a)](#a) and [(b)](#b), the [Administrator](/usc/15/9701.md?p=1) shall use the inventory created under [subsection (c)](#c).
